对象转换和instanceof操作符;清楚父类型与子类型之间的关系 能分清对象的类型; 理解引用变量类型与其指向的对象的类型 理解类型转换和显式向下转换的必要性 掌握instanceof操作符的使用 ;3;如果类Student是类Person的子类,类Undergraduate是类Student的子类,请指出以下代码行中 哪些是不合法的。 1、Person p1 = new Student( ); 2、Person p2 = new Undergraduate( ); 3、Student s1 = new Person( ); 4、Student s2 = new Undergraduate( ); 5、Undergraduate ug1 = new Person( ); 6、Undergraduate ug2 = new Student( ); 7、Object obj = new Student( );; 对象 instanceof 类名 (p370) 判断某个对象是不是属于那个类名所指定的类,返回true或false ;对象进行强制类型转换时,必须保证当前对象确实是目标类型,否则
2022-05-12 18:04:58 160KB 源码软件
1
JS中typeof与instanceof之间的区别总结.docx
2022-01-21 09:10:33 16KB 开发
这是分享按钮: <button onclick="call()">通用分享</button> <button onclick="call('wechatFriend')">微信好友</button> <button onclick="call('wechatTimeline')">朋友圈</button> <button onclick="call('qqFriend')">QQ</button> <button onclick="call('qZone')">QQ空间</button> <button onclick="call('weibo')">微博</button>  这是js调用代
2021-11-17 14:30:18 58KB html5 instanceof object
1
在某游戏系统中,有猫、狗、猪三种动物。 (1) 三者都有吃的行为,建立一个动物类作为他们的父类,但是三种动物吃的行为都不相同,猫吃老鼠、狗吃骨头、猪吃饲料 (2) 此外,在自身的特有行为中,猫可抓老鼠,狗能看家护院,猪特别擅长睡觉 (3) 建立测试程序1,该程序有一个方法eatfunction(Animal a),根据传递进来的动物的不同,分别调用他们的吃的行为和特有的行为 (4) 建立测试程序2,定义一个ArrayList的链表对象,定义三个对象,分别是猫、狗、猪,然后放置3个对象到该链表对象。循环该链表,取出每一个,调用他们的公共行为和他们各自的行为。 考察知识点:继承、多态、instanceof
2021-10-13 22:03:00 3KB Java 类的继承 多态 instanceof
ElectronJS instanceof bug 演示 这演示了在 Windows 上使用 ElectronJS 时 instanceof 的错误。 问题: : 运行测试 电子测试: npm run test-electron 节点测试: npm run test-node
2021-06-08 13:04:15 3KB JavaScript
1
ES5的instanceof手写实现
2021-04-18 11:04:32 935B js
1